## Formula sandbox tuning

User-supplied formulas in Gridmoor execute inside a restricted interpreter with hard ceilings on time, memory, and call depth. Reviewers should confirm any change to these ceilings is justified in the PR description, since raising them widens the abuse surface. Defaults were chosen from production traces. The current limits are as follows.

limits module of tafog-fawip:
WEIGHTS = {
    "julix": 57,
    "lamys": 992,
    "kasvan": 209,
    "quenok": 750,
    "alddor": 259,
    "oliath": 1009,
    "wenix": 815,
}

Leadership Review Briefing — Hollowmere Pilot

The 12-store pilot with Hollowmere Market is in week six. Sell-through is 18% above forecast; stockouts occurred at three locations. Shelf placement drove most of the variance. Hollowmere has signaled interest in a 60-store expansion pending Q3 results. Branch managers should prepare capacity estimates by month-end. Review the confidential item below before any external discussion.

internal memo for yahag-tahog: The pricing group signed off on a budget of $152.8 million for Project Soriel.

Meeting notes — 10/14, Coldvault archiving

- Cold storage buckets older than 18 months move to the Glacierline tier.
- Archive job runs weekly; manifest written before deletion.
- Reviewer: verify checksum step isn't skipped when manifest exceeds 10k objects — known edge case.
- Restore SLA documented in runbook; no code changes needed there.
- PR up by Friday.

All archiving changes require approval from the designated owner:

signatory, bagug-hawep: Praius Holion

## Project Amberline — Possible Acquisition (Managers Only)

Heads of department should be aware that Fennic Industrial is in early diligence on Brask Tooling, a mid-sized fabricator based in Olvester. Rationale: capacity, regional coverage, and the Brask coating process. Diligence runs six weeks; no staff communications until cleared. Direct any questions through your divisional lead only. The confidential deal context is set out below.

board note of bawep-tajef: Queniusek Systems plans to raise the Quenvan list price by 53.1 percent in March. The pricing group signed off on a budget of $176.4 million for Project Drueth. The renewal with Casionix Partners closes at $142.5 million a year, 8.3 percent below the last contract. Project Fraax slips by six weeks because of the tooling delay.